A read or write operation to the DMAR register accesses the register located at the address
(TIMx_CR1 address) + (DBA + DMA index) x 4
where TIMx_CR1 address is the address of the control register 1, DBA is the DMA base
address configured in TIMx_DCR register, DMA index is automatically controlled by the DMA
transfer, and ranges from 0 to DBL (DBL configured in TIMx_DCR).

00: TIM1_ETR is not connected to any AWD
01: TIM1_ETR is connected to ADC1 AWD1
10: TIM1_ETR is connected to ADC1 AWD2
11: TIM1_ETR is connected to ADC1 AWD3
